## Account Recovery — Trailnote Offline Mode

When a surveyor's Trailnote app has been offline for 30+ days, their local credentials expire and sync refuses to resume. Don't make them wipe the device — all their unsynced field data lives there! Instead, open the support console, pick "Offline Reinstate," and enter their handle. The console will ask for the support team's shared recovery passphrase before issuing a reinstatement token. Use the one below.

unlock words, bagaf-fajeg: zorael-kelax-fraath-quenix-eliok-sileth-aldmir-wenir-druiel

## Releases

New Pickform builds drop roughly every two weeks. Grab the latest optimizer core from the releases page, and make sure your plugin targets the matching API tier — we do break things between tiers, sorry. Every release tarball is signed, so verify before you build against it. The public verification key is right here.

rollout seal: bky4_DFM9

**Key Ceremony Checklist — Item 7: Bounceward Processor**

Before rotating keys for the Bounceward email bounce processor, confirm the suppression list has been exported and verified by two support leads. Pause the intake queue, note the timestamp in the ceremony log, and ensure both witnesses are present in the room. When the custodian asks for unlock credentials, read aloud the recovery passphrase below.

vault phrase of tajop-haduf = holath-brivan-wenax